Dr. Michele Yasson
Dr. Yasson is a graduate of Rutgers University and the University of Missouri College of Veterinary Medicine, and has been practicing in New York since 1985. She is an active member of the Academy of Veterinary Homeopathy, the American Veterinary Medical Association, the American Holistic Veterinary Medical Association, the National Center for Homeopathy, and the International Veterinary Acupuncture Society. She is certified by the International Veterinary Acupuncture Society, the leading authority in veterinary acupuncture in the United States. Dr. Yasson is considered a pioneering elder in the field of natural veterinary medicine and has been featured in numerous books, expos and conferences, newspaper and magazine stories, and radio and television programs. What is veterinary homeopathy?
Homeopathy (Latin: homeo=same, pathos=illness) is a system of medical treatment developed 200 years ago in Germany by Dr. Samuel Hahnemann. It is a method of stimulating the body to heal itself and is commonly used all over the world. For example, in England there are several exclusively homeopathic hospitals and in France homeopathic medicines can be found in nearly every pharmacy.

How is veterinary homeopathy done?
Homeopathic medications are generally administered orally. Their effects begin instantly and can last a few minutes to many months, depending on the condition being treated and the potency used. Each prescription is specifically matched to the patient’s whole condition. This includes the physical, mental, and emotional state of the patient. The owner’s accurate report of these details make their role a critical one in homeopathic treatment.
